Innoshima Suigun Castle: Day Trip from Hiroshima (64 km) – Location & Nearest Station
Innoshima Suigun Castle is a museum in Onomichi, Hiroshima Prefecture, about 64 km in a straight line from Hiroshima Station. That distance puts it within day-trip range of Hiroshima for most travellers, depending on train connections.

| Type | Museum |
|---|---|
| Name in Japanese | 因島水軍城 |
| Location | Onomichi, Hiroshima Prefecture |
| Nearest station (straight line) | Sunami Station – about 8.9 km |
| From Hiroshima Station | about 64 km (straight line) |
| From Osaka Station | about 217 km (straight line) |
| From Kyoto Station | about 248 km (straight line) |
| Coordinates | 34.32800, 133.16639 |
| Map | Open in Google Maps |
| Official website | https://kanko-innoshima.jp/sightseeing_leisure/suigunjo |

- The closest railway station by straight-line distance is Sunami Station, about 8.9 km away. The most convenient station can be a different one, so check a route planner before you go.
- Distances on this page are straight-line figures calculated from map coordinates. Real travel time depends on the route and transfers.
- Opening days, hours and prices change. Please confirm them on the official website linked above before you travel.
- Showing staff the Japanese name (因島水軍城) helps when you ask for directions.
